Brian's Simple Races

Description
Adds five new races and 3 new factions.

Treekin Race:
Treekin are humans with the characteristics of nature and the forests. The Ent Men are known for their thoughtful calm and when forced to battle their mighty trunks. The Nymph women are known for their beauty, sensitive caring nature, and extreme fertility. All Treekin feel a natural peace. Fire however is a natural vulnerability for their timber bodies.

Forest Tribe Faction:
The Treekin have nurtured these forests for countless generations. They live off the natural gardens, and gauranlen groves that thrive in their presence. Tight knit families bow to a council of elders. With the abundance of nature around them aggression is rarely useful to them, but when pressed they are well prepared to defend themselves and their home.

Blue Macaque Race: The Blue Macaques where first engineered slaves to craft at assemble lines. Given monkey-like characteristics in order to effectively manipulate their crafts. However their makers were happy to have them live fast and die young, as they neglected their long term health and their physical prowess. Many have escaped their captors and sought new life out on the rim.

Rescues Race:
The Rescues volunteered to be engineered to be perfect in the field of emergency services. They gained immense skill in putting out fires and patching up wounded, but in their selflessness, lost their own health, even optimizing their brain to the neglect of all else, causing many to be unable to help themselves. Such selflessness also lead to many being taken advantage of. Successive generations became unhappy with their selfless lifestyle as they were unappreciated and abused. They chose to leave, causing a war with those who had become complacent and reliant on their skills.

Manics Race:
The Manics became a slave to their own art, thus eachother and themselves. They made themselves the perfect sculptures of food and marble, in order to please the gaze of critics and oligarchs. They now hold a hearth in their belly, causing the fires of passion to spew from them. Most are still serving in kitchens and workshops across the worlds, but some have resisted the culture of their ancestors and left to find more in life than simple material perfection.

Heavys Race:
In civilizations on the rim, it’s common practice to use strong prisoners in heavy labor. Some have become generational slaves, messily introduced to genes to further optimize this purpose. This lesser class became known as Heavys. In time they gained strength enough that they could no longer be restrained by their masters. They however hold the scars of genetic deformities introduced to make them appear less human, in order to satisfy the upper classes' need for cognitive dissonance and superiority.

Civil Refuge Faction:
Assorted slave races escaped to the rim to start a new life. These people have found peace and safety in each other. Each race being optimized for specific purposes have found they are able to live together to reach greater prosperity than any could achieve alone, maintaining and improving on their industrial age civilization. They are generally agreeable to peace with other nations.

Refugee Pirates faction:
Assorted slave races have banded together in anger for their old masters. They have taken to raiding and pillaging in order to support their ongoing quest of vengeance.
